God the Father is the first Person of the Trinity, which also includes his Son, Jesus Christ, and the Holy Spirit.

Christians believe there is one God who exists in three Persons.

This mystery of the faith cannot be fully understood by the human mind but is a key doctrine of Christianity.

While the word Trinity does not appear in the Bible, several episodes include the simultaneous appearance of Father, Son, and Holy Spirit, such as the baptism of Jesus by John the Baptist.

We find many names for God in the Bible.

Jesus urged us to think of God as our loving father and went a step further by calling him Abba, an Aramaic word roughly translated as «Daddy,» to show us how intimate our relationship with him is.

God the Father is the perfect example for all earthly fathers. He is holy, just, and fair, but his most outstanding quality is love:

Whoever does not love does not know God, because God is love.

(1 John 4:8, NIV)
God’s love motivates everything he does.

Through his covenant with Abraham, he chose the Jews as his people, then nurtured and protected them, despite their frequent disobedience.

In his greatest act of love, God the Father sent his only Son to be the perfect sacrifice for the sin of all humanity, Jews and Gentiles alike.
